This is the complete list of members for
cdb::Table, including all inherited members.
_add_ref(void) | cdb::Table | [inline] |
_rem_ref(void) | cdb::Table | [inline] |
CreateRecord(const String &strRecordName, Boolean bTruncate=FALSE)=0 | cdb::Table | [pure virtual] |
GetChildren(const String &strRecordName, StringArray &astrChildren)=0 | cdb::Table | [pure virtual] |
GetField(const String &strRecordName, const String &strFieldName, Field &fld)=0 | cdb::Table | [pure virtual] |
GetParent(const String &strRecordName, String &strParent) | cdb::Table | [virtual] |
GetRecord(const String &strRecordName, Record &rec, Boolean bCreate=FALSE, Boolean bAppend=FALSE)=0 | cdb::Table | [pure virtual] |
GetRecordState(const String &strRecordName)=0 | cdb::Table | [pure virtual] |
GetRoot(String &strRoot) | cdb::Table | [inline, virtual] |
isInitialized()=0 | cdb::Table | [pure virtual] |
Lock(Boolean bExclusiveWrite=0) | cdb::Table | |
m_bWriteLock | cdb::Table | [private] |
m_nRefCount | cdb::Table | [private] |
NamedField typedef | cdb::Table | |
NamedFieldArray typedef | cdb::Table | |
RemoveField(const String &strRecordName, const String &strFieldName)=0 | cdb::Table | [pure virtual] |
RemoveRecord(const String &strRecordName)=0 | cdb::Table | [pure virtual] |
SetField(const String &strRecordName, const String &strFieldName, const Field &fld, Boolean bCreate=TRUE)=0 | cdb::Table | [pure virtual] |
SetRecord(const String &strRecordName, const Record &rec, Boolean bCreate=TRUE, Boolean bAll=TRUE)=0 | cdb::Table | [pure virtual] |
Table() | cdb::Table | |
Unlock(Boolean bExclusiveWrite=0) | cdb::Table | |
~Table() | cdb::Table | [virtual] |